Encryption protects the contents against an unwanted party reading it. Digital signatures make sure that it was not modified and comes from a specific sender.<\/p>\n<p>Gpg4win supports both relevant cryptography standards, <b>OpenPGP<\/b> and <b>S\/MIME (X.509)<\/b>. Gpg4win is the official GnuPG distribution for Windows and is maintained by the developers of GnuPG. Gpg4win and the software included with Gpg4win are Free Software (Open Source; among other things free of charge for all commercial and non-commercial purposes).<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: right; font-style: italic; font-size: 0.8em;\">Source: http:\/\/gpg4win.org\/about.html<\/p>\n<p>You can download Gpg4win software from download page: http:\/\/gpg4win.org\/download.html<br \/>\nAs for today <b>Gpg4win 2.1.0<\/b> contains: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>GnuPG 2.0.17<\/li>\n<li>Kleopatra 2.1.0 (2011-02-04)<\/li>\n<li>GPA 0.9.1-svn1024<\/li>\n<li>GpgOL 1.1.2<\/li>\n<li>GpgEX 0.9.7<\/li>\n<li>Claws Mail 3.7.8cvs47<\/li>\n<li>Kompendium (de) 3.0.0<\/li>\n<li>Compendium (en) 3.0.0-beta1<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>You can also download Lite version of Gpg4win, without Kleopatra and manuals, but I will use and refer to the full version.<\/p>\n<p>It is recommended to <a href=\"http:\/\/gpg4win.org\/package-integrity.html\">verify the integrity of your Gpg4win package<\/a>, but in Microsoft Windows you do not have built-in tool for this purpose. You can install third-party tool for this, like <a href=\"http:\/\/code.kliu.org\/hashcheck\/\">HashCheck<\/a>, <a href=\"http:\/\/implbits.com\/HashTab.aspx\">HashTab<\/a> or other. I think I will write separate article about hash verification. For now you can click twice on gpg4win-ver.exe to install Gpg4win. File has verified issuer: Intevation GmbH, so you can install it safely.<br \/>\nWith a default installation options (which I used), at the end of the setup wizard, appears the window where you can define trustable root certificates for S\/MIME. I skipped this option because S\/MIME is not the focus of this article. So, install them as described in this window or check the box &#8220;Root certificate defined or skip configuration&#8221; as I have done and click &#8220;Next &gt;&#8221; to finish setup.<br \/>\nNow you can open Windows shell prompt (left Win key, cmd ) and check gpg version and alghoritms (my output below \/Windows 7 Professional, Polish version\/).<\/p>\n<pre><code>\r\nC:\\Users\\DrFugazi&gt;gpg --version\r\ngpg (GnuPG) 2.0.17 (Gpg4win 2.1.0)\r\nlibgcrypt 1.4.6\r\nCopyright (C) 2011 Free Software Foundation, Inc.\r\nLicense GPLv3+: GNU GPL version 3 or later &lt;http:\/\/gnu.org\/licenses\/gpl.html&gt;\r\nThis is free software: you are free to change and redistribute it.\r\nThere is NO WARRANTY, to the extent permitted by law.\r\n\r\nHome: C:\/Users\/DrFugazi\/AppData\/Roaming\/gnupg\r\nObs\u2502ugiwane algorytmy:\r\nAsymetryczne: RSA, ELG, DSA\r\nSymetryczne: 3DES, CAST5, BLOWFISH, AES, AES192, AES256, TWOFISH, CAMELLIA128,\r\n             CAMELLIA192, CAMELLIA256\r\nSkr\u02c7t\u02c7w: MD5, SHA1, RIPEMD160, SHA256, SHA384, SHA512, SHA224\r\nKompresji: Nieskompresowany, ZIP, ZLIB, BZIP2\r\n\r\nC:\\Users\\DrFugazi&gt;\r\n<\/code><\/pre>\n<p>Now you should generate your private\/public keypair with CLI, Kleopatra or other utility.<\/p>","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Gpg4win (GNU Privacy Guard for Windows) is an encryption software for files and emails.<\/p>\n<h3>What is Gpg4win?<\/h3>\n<p>Gpg4win enables users to securely transport emails and files with the help of encryption and digital signatures.
